9+ Easy Ways: Calculate Average Reaction Rate Now

The determination of the speed at which a chemical transformation proceeds over a specific time interval involves calculating the change in reactant or product concentration divided by the duration of that interval. For example, if the concentration of a reactant decreases by 0.5 moles per liter over 10 seconds, the average rate is 0.05 moles per liter per second.

Quantifying the mean velocity of a chemical process provides a practical understanding of how quickly a reaction reaches completion under specified conditions. This information is essential for optimizing industrial processes, predicting product yields, and assessing reaction mechanisms. Historically, such calculations have been crucial for advancements in chemical kinetics and reactor design, allowing for better control and efficiency in chemical synthesis.

Free OSHA Incident Rate Calculator: 2024 Guide

A tool used to quantify workplace safety is a method for calculating the number of work-related injuries and illnesses per 100 full-time employees during a one-year period. This metric provides a standardized way to evaluate safety performance across different companies and industries. As an example, a rate of 3.0 indicates that for every 100 full-time employees, three recordable incidents occurred during the year.

This calculation is crucial for identifying trends, tracking progress in safety improvements, and comparing performance against industry benchmarks. Its historical context lies in the need for consistent and objective measurement of workplace safety, leading to the development of standardized formulas and reporting requirements. Utilizing this standardized metric facilitates continuous improvement in safety programs and enhances overall worker protection.

7+ Easy Steps: How to Calculate Photosynthesis Rate

Determining the pace at which plants and other organisms convert light energy into chemical energy is fundamental to understanding biological productivity. This process involves measuring the uptake of carbon dioxide and/or the release of oxygen over a specific period, often normalized to leaf area or biomass. For instance, a researcher might measure the amount of carbon dioxide absorbed by a leaf in a sealed chamber under controlled light and temperature conditions, then divide that value by the leaf’s surface area to arrive at a rate expressed as micromoles of CO2 per square meter per second.

Quantifying this biological activity provides insights into plant health, ecosystem function, and the impact of environmental factors such as light intensity, temperature, and water availability. These measurements are crucial for modeling global carbon cycles, assessing the effects of climate change on vegetation, and optimizing agricultural practices to enhance crop yields. Historically, methods have evolved from simple gas exchange measurements to sophisticated techniques employing infrared gas analyzers and chlorophyll fluorescence.

Fast HRR: Calculate Heart Rate Recovery + Tips

The method involves assessing the decrease in an individual’s heartbeats per minute following the cessation of physical exertion. Specifically, it is the difference between peak heart rate achieved during exercise and the heart rate one minute after stopping that exercise. For instance, if a person’s heart rate reaches 180 beats per minute at the end of a run, and then drops to 150 beats per minute one minute later, the difference is 30 beats per minute.

Assessing cardiovascular function through this metric provides valuable insights into overall health and fitness. A faster return to a lower rate following activity generally indicates better cardiovascular fitness and autonomic nervous system function. Historically, medical professionals have used this measurement to identify individuals at higher risk for cardiovascular events and all-cause mortality, making it a significant prognostic indicator.

Get 8+ Free Rental Property Cap Rate Calculators Now!

A device or software application designed to estimate the capitalization rate of a prospective income-producing real estate investment. It facilitates the analysis of potential profitability by automating the calculation using key inputs such as the property’s net operating income (NOI) and current market value or purchase price. For instance, by inputting an NOI of $50,000 and a property value of $1,000,000, the tool promptly displays a capitalization rate of 5%.

These tools are valuable resources for real estate investors, appraisers, and lenders, offering a simplified method for evaluating the relative value and potential return on investment (ROI) of different properties. Its historical significance stems from the need for a standardized metric to compare investment opportunities across various markets and property types. The ease of use ensures a more consistent and efficient assessment process, reducing the time and effort required for manual calculations and minimizing the risk of errors.
